Ex-Employee of Wayland Business Embezzled $111K: Police

David Rodriguez, of Southborough, was taken to Framingham District Court for arraignment.

WAYLAND, MA -A man is accused of embezzling at least $111,000 from a local Wayland business, police said.

The business reported on April 14 that ex-employee David Rodriguez, of Southborough, had embezzled the money, police said.

Detective Sergeant Jamie Berger conducted an interview and obtained a warrant for Rodriguez's bank records, police said.

After the investigation Rodriguez was charged with Larceny over $250 by embezzlement and transported to Framingham District Court for arraignment, police said.
